VIOLET DAIQUIRI

The daiquiri is a type of cocktail made from white rhum and lemon or lime juice. The name daiquiri is also the name of a beach near Santiago, Cuba and an iron mine in the area. It was invented by an american engineer who worked in the mine, Jennings Cox, who created this drink when his gin ran out and he had some guests over.

Ingredients
3 Year Old Habana Rum (4cl)
Fresh Lime Juice (1cl)
Drop of Marasqui­no Liquor
1 Drop of Violet Liquor

Preparation:

Place the ingredients in a cocktail shaker with ice, shake and pour into a long drink glass. Decorate with fruits and if desired, add crushed ice.
